Material Removal Mechanisms of Cemented Carbides Machined by Ultrasonic Vibration Assisted EDM in Gas Medium

Abstract:A new electrical discharge machining (EDM) technology-tool electrode Ultrasonic vibration assisted electrical discharge machining in gas medium (UEDM in gas) is proposed and its principle is introduced. Relevant experimental equipment was designed by which a series of experiments of machining cemented carbide material were carried out. The mechanisms of cemented carbide material removal are discussed in detail through observing and analyzing the microstructures of machined surface. Five material removal mechanisms of cemented carbides machined by UEDM in gas were proposed, which are melting and evaporation, oxidation and decomposition, spalling, the force of high pressure gas and affection of ultrasonic vibration etc.
